Development in Chhattisgarh is only in posters and banners,says PM Modi

 RAIPUR:Prime Minister Narendra Modi today laid the foundation stone and inaugurated several projects in Chhattisgarh.

While addressing a rally in Jagdalpur, PM Modi said that the entire country is watching the condition of Chhattisgarh by Congress in the last five years. Corruption is prevalent all around, crime is at its peak, Chhattisgarh has reached among the leading states in terms of murders. They throw dust in people's eyes and do corruption. Congress has given a scam government. That is why today only one voice is coming from every corner of the state. Everyone is doing the same, we can't tolerate it anymore. Will keep changing,Modi said.

PM Modi said that development in Chhattisgarh is visible only in posts and banners or it is seen in the coffers of Congress leaders. Congress has given only false propaganda and scam government to Chhattisgarh. That is why today only one voice is coming from every corner of Chhattisgarh, Au nai sahibo badal ke rahibo.

In comparison to Congress, BJP government gives 5 times more budget for tribal society. If they give 1 rupee, we give 5 rupees and if they give 100 rupees, we give 500 rupees. It was the BJP government, which created a separate tribal ministry at the center and made the budget.Congress also ignored Bastar for decades and did not care about you people,Modi alleged.

 

 

 PM Modi said that this is the BJP government, medical and engineering colleges should be built here, education city should be built in Dantewada. "I have spent a large part of my life in tribal areas. I have a direct relationship with you, it is a relationship of the heart. I am proud that BJP got the honor of making the first woman President of the country. Our government gives five times more budget for tribals. BJP itself declared 15th November i.e. the birthday of Lord Birsa Munda as Tribal Day. We increased scholarships. Opened tribal schools. Big projects related to education, health and employment are going to start here. Building modern infrastructure".

Today a very big and most modern steel factory of the country has been inaugurated in Nagarnar on which the people of Chhattisgarh are proud, but the Congress government of the state is not. Such a big programme has just taken place but neither the Chief Minister nor the Deputy Chief Minister of Chhattisgarh Congress came. Even not a single Congress minister participated in the programme. There are two reasons for this - First: He is so worried about the government going down that he is busy saving the government. Second: This is Modi and no stubborn corrupt person can make eye contact with Modi, hence they are afraid of coming and run away.
